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$56.44 | 4.347% | $58.8934 | $58.89 | $58.90 | $58.90 |
Purchase #2 | $109.75 | 6.363% | $116.7334 | $116.73 | $116.75 | $116.70 |
Purchase #3 | $223.54 | 10.515% | $247.0452 | $247.05 | $247.05 | $247.00 |
Purchase #4 | $165.27 | 7.216% | $177.1959 | $177.20 | $177.20 | $177.20 |
Purchase #5 | $100.87 | 8.609% | $109.5539 | $109.55 | $109.55 | $109.60 |
Purchase #6 | $153.71 | 4.523% | $160.6623 | $160.66 | $160.65 | $160.70 |
Purchase #7 | $180.51 | 10.690% | $199.8065 | $199.81 | $199.80 | $199.80 |
7 purchase totals = | $990.09 | $1,069.8906 | $1,069.89 | $1,069.90 | $1,069.90 |
